Mandeville council adopts 2026 St. Tammany Parish multi-jurisdiction hazard mitigation plan
Summary
Council adopted Resolution 26-04 to adopt the 2026 St. Tammany Parish Multi-Jurisdiction Hazard Mitigation Plan, bringing the city into the parish-level mitigation planning framework.

The Mandeville City Council adopted Resolution 26-04 on Feb. 26 to adopt the 2026 St. Tammany Parish Multi-Jurisdiction Hazard Mitigation Plan.
The measure places the city within the parish's updated mitigation planning framework for hazards such as flooding and storms. The resolution was presented to the council and included on the meeting agenda; the minutes record adoption without recorded dissent.
The meeting minutes do not include the plan's detailed measures, cost estimates, or implementation schedule; those items are typically contained in the full parish mitigation plan document and supporting staff reports rather than the council minutes.
